The Regulatory Landscape in Italy
Before purchasing any supplement or dietary aid, one should comprehend that Italy, as a member of the European Union, imposes rigorous guidelines regarding health and health products. The Italian Ministry of Health (Ministero della Salute) supervises the security, labeling, and circulation of food supplements.
Unlike some global markets where unregulated active ingredients flow freely, Italy needs rigorous testing. Weight loss items sold legally within the country usually fall under 2 classifications:
- Food Supplements (Integratori Alimentari): Regulated similarly to foods, these include vitamins, minerals, herbs, or amino acids. They can not claim to "treat" weight problems, but they can support typical metabolism or decrease tiredness.
- Medical Devices & & Pharmaceuticals: Products that suppress hunger or block fat absorption typically need CE marking or a doctor's prescription.
Where to Buy Weight Loss Products in Italy
Consumers have numerous channels offered when buying weight-loss help. Each alternative features unique advantages and factors to consider.
1. Conventional Pharmacies (Farmacie)
Drug stores are perhaps the best place to purchase weight-loss products in Italy. Pharmacists are extremely trained healthcare professionals who can supply personalized suggestions.
- Pros: Guaranteed credibility, professional assistance, schedule of medically approved items.
- Cons: Prices can be greater compared to online sellers.
2. Parapharmacies (Parafarmacie)
These are retail outlets comparable to pharmacies, however they do not sell prescription medications. Instead, they concentrate on non-prescription drugs, cosmetics, and dietary supplements.
- Pros: Wider selection of natural and organic supplements, educated staff, frequently more inexpensive than traditional pharmacies.
- Cons: Still physically bound to brick-and-mortar locations.
3. Herbalist Shops (Erboristerie)
Italy has a deep-rooted tradition of herbalism. Erboristerie are specialized stores focusing on plant-based solutions, teas, and natural supplements.
- Pros: Excellent for those looking for organic, herbal, or holistic weight management options (e.g., green tea extracts, garcinia cambogia, or draining pipes herbal teas).
- Cons: Products are typically limited to natural components and may not match those searching for advanced clinical formulas.
4. E-commerce and Online Retailers
The convenience of shopping online has actually transformed the Italian supplement market. Consumers can purchase straight from brand websites, significant Italian health platforms, or worldwide giants like Amazon Italy.
- Pros: Huge range, competitive pricing, consumer evaluations, home shipment.
- Cons: Risk of counterfeit items; shipping delays from outside the EU.
Popular Categories of Weight Loss Supplements in Italy
When searching Italian health stores, shoppers generally encounter a few primary categories of weight-loss help:
- Metabolism Boosters: Often containing caffeine, green tea extract, or bitter orange (arancio amaro), these goal to increase daily caloric expense.
- Draining Pipes and Purifying Agents (Drenanti): Highly popular in Italy, these organic beverages (often containing birch, dandelion, or horsetail) target water retention and bloating instead of fat loss.
- Hunger Suppressants: Products containing glucomannan (a dietary fiber) that broaden in the stomach to promote a sensation of fullness.
- Carbohydrate and Fat Blockers: Ingredients meant to inhibit the enzymes responsible for absorbing fats and carbs.

4. What is a drenante, and why is it so popular in Italy?
A drenante (draining pipes supplement) is a liquid natural concentrate diluted in water and taken in throughout the day. Italians often use them to fight water retention, lower swelling, and assistance microcirculation.
